Abstract

An ejection pistol for double-walled cartridges comprises a hand-operated pistol grip, a trough-shaped half shell, a piston rod mounted displaceably therein, and a substantially circular ejection plate disposed at the front end of the piston rod. A cylindrical tube open on one side contains two cylindrical rams disposed coaxially with each other and with the longitudinal axis of the tube.

Claims (2)

  1. An ejection gun for double wall cartridges (1), consisting of a manually operated gun grip, a trough-like half shell, a piston rod displaceably mounted therein and a substantially circular ejection plate, characterised by a cylindrical tube (9) which is open at one end and is releasably and displaceably disposed in the trough-like half shell, in which tube are fixed two plungers (10, 11), disposed spaced from each other, wherein the plungers (10, 11) are in the form of a cylinder and are attached to the base of the tube (13), coaxially to each other and to the longitudinal axis of the tube (9).
  2. An ejection gun according to claim 1, characterised in that the length of the plungers (10, 11), which are of different diameters, is smaller than the length of the cylindrical tube (9).
